
The correct completion is “cannot modify the settings of” because built-in agents such as the Researcher agent in Microsoft 365 Copilot are system-defined experiences. These agents are designed and managed by Microsoft to ensure consistent functionality, security, compliance, and alignment with responsible AI standards.
While users can interact with Researcher, provide prompts, and refine outputs during conversations, they cannot directly modify the core system settings or configuration of the built-in agent from Microsoft 365. Administrative configuration and deeper customization are available when creating custom Copilot agents through approved development tools, but default Microsoft-provided agents have controlled configurations.
Options such as modifying agent instructions, adding prompts, or deleting suggested prompts imply direct structural customization of the built-in agent interface, which is not supported in the standard Microsoft 365 Copilot experience.
This reflects a key generative AI governance principle in enterprise environments: system-level controls remain centrally managed to maintain data protection, compliance, and responsible AI implementation across the organization.
